Dante’s Desperate Hunt for Rocco: What’s Afoot in Port Charles?
Let’s dive right into the heart of the matter: Dante and Rocco. My mind immediately flashes back to the devastating moment when Lulu Falconeri (Emme Rylan) slipped into that coma. My heart just shattered for Dante, having to explain to his young son that his mother wouldn’t be coming home anytime soon. Rocco (currently played by O’Neill Monahan, but a character we’ve watched grow up on screen!) has been living in France with his grandparents, Laura (the legendary Genie Francis) and Kevin Collins (Jon Lindstrom), for what feels like an eternity. It’s been a safe haven, but also a poignant reminder of Lulu’s absence.
Now, Dante getting a ‘lead’ on Rocco – what could this possibly mean? Is Rocco in danger? Has something happened in France that necessitates his return to Port Charles? Or is Dante, still reeling from Lulu’s condition, simply desperate to have his son closer to him, perhaps hoping Rocco’s presence might somehow stir Lulu from her sleep? As a true Falconeri, Dante carries the weight of his family on his shoulders. He’s Sonny’s (Maurice Benard) son, Olivia’s (Lisa LoCicero) boy, and a devoted father. If Rocco is in any sort of trouble, Dante will move heaven and earth. Remember his unwavering dedication as a detective? That fierce loyalty and protective instinct will be on full display.

Britt’s Battle Intensifies: A ‘Bad Way’ for the Britch
My heart goes out to Britt Westbourne. Kelly Thiebaud has delivered such a nuanced, powerful performance as a character who started as ‘The Britch’ and evolved into one of Port Charles’s most beloved and complex figures. Her Huntington’s diagnosis has been a dark cloud hanging over her, a ticking time bomb that has colored every decision she’s made. We’ve seen her struggle, her denial, her acceptance, and the sheer bravery she’s shown in the face of such a terrifying illness.
The spoiler says she’s in a ‘bad way.’ This sends chills down my spine. Is it a severe flare-up of her symptoms, making her condition impossible to hide? Is she facing a new medical crisis related to her diagnosis? Or is it an emotional breakdown, the cumulative weight of her prognosis, her complicated love life (poor Jason Morgan, and now Cody Bell!), and the stress of her demanding job as Chief of Staff finally catching up to her?
You know Liesl Obrecht (the magnificent Kathleen Gati) will be a force to be reckoned with if her daughter is suffering. Liesl will stop at nothing, absolutely nothing, to protect and save Britt. We’ve seen her go to extreme lengths before, and I predict she’ll unleash her full ‘Mama Bear’ fury if Britt’s health takes a turn for the worse. And what about Cody (Josh Kelly)?
